Differences From Artifact [865115b836]:
- File src/platform.h — part of check-in [41a9ba7c06] at 2023-07-15 15:03:07 on branch trunk — platform.h: Fix the define for HURD (user: js, size: 4416) [annotate] [blame] [check-ins using]
To Artifact [d6a36db1b5]:
- File
src/platform.h
— part of check-in
[6d93db9f98]
at
2023-07-15 16:12:34
on branch trunk
— Add support for GNU/Hurd
Hurd does not have PATH_MAX, so different APIs need to be used on Hurd. (user: js, size: 4459) [annotate] [blame] [check-ins using] [more...]
︙ | ︙ | |||
150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 | #elif defined(__riscos__) # define OF_ACORN_RISC_OS #elif defined(__MINT__) # define OF_MINT #elif defined(__gnu_hurd__) # define OF_HURD #endif #if defined(__ELF__) # define OF_ELF #elif defined(__MACH__) # define OF_MACH_O #endif #if defined(__PIC__) || defined(__pic__) # define OF_PIC #endif | > > > > | 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 | #elif defined(__riscos__) # define OF_ACORN_RISC_OS #elif defined(__MINT__) # define OF_MINT #elif defined(__gnu_hurd__) # define OF_HURD #endif #ifdef __GLIBC__ # define OF_GLIBC #endif #if defined(__ELF__) # define OF_ELF #elif defined(__MACH__) # define OF_MACH_O #endif #if defined(__PIC__) || defined(__pic__) # define OF_PIC #endif |